There is always something going on in La Quinta, because it is such an interesting city. It is one of the world’s most amazing golf destinations as well, mainly thanks to the La Quinta Resort and Club. This was constructed in 1926 and was also used for the Lost Horizon screenplay, by director Frank Capra.

Another fantastic golf course is The Quarry, which is one of the top 100 courses in this country. Additionally, the SilverRock Golf Resort was one of four golf courses used during the Bob Hope Chrysler Classic PGA golf tournament.
